CNVP North Macedonia and Sar Mountain National Park held a joint meeting in Tetovo

On November 16, a working meeting between the CNVP North Macedonia team and the Sar Mountain National Park team was held in Tetovo. The purpose of the meeting was to jointly discuss the envisaged project activities for the coming period within the framework of the project ‘’Sustainable use of natural resources for transboundary socio-economic development of protected areas in North Macedonia and Albania (Shar, Korab-Koritnik and Albanian Alps)’’.

At the beginning of the meeting, CNVP introduced the project team and emphasized the importance of collaboration with Sar Mountain National Park (SMNP) as a strategic partner in the further implementation of the project, aiming for a joint contribution to the preservation of biodiversity but also the socio-economic development of Sar Mountain and the entire region.

A short presentation about the concrete project was made by the CNVP team, emphasizing the main project milestones, expected results and impacts, beneficiaries, and partners. It was clarified that the focus of the project is the entire region of mountains Shar, Korab- Koritnik until the Albanian Alps, emphasizing that Sar Mountain is a very important part of the project's focus.

In this initial phase, the project’s focus will be on conducting research activities in three dimensions, such as biodiversity, tourism, and non-wood forest products, while the obtained information will serve as an important input for derived actions that will follow.

The Sar Mountain National Park, thanked the CNVP team for their support and emphasized the further cooperation and joint initiatives in the direction of preserving the Sar Mountain. SMNP committed to sharing all the research done so far on Sar Mountain, while emphasizing that the institution is attempting to have a complete picture of the Sharri region.

Both teams reviewed in detail the draft annual program 2023 of the SMNP and extracted concrete activities to be supported by CNVP during the upcoming year. Hereby, both parties showed willingness for the concrete activities for the next period to be streamlined into a joint memorandum of cooperation, which will be signed in the near future.

The project ’Sustainable use of natural resources for transboundary socio-economic development of protected areas in North Macedonia and Albania (Korab-Koritnik, Shar and Albanian Alps)’’ is implemented by CNVP, with financial support from PONT. The project aims to promote sustainable use of the natural resources, monitoring, and management of important habitats and species through the provision of and support to local communities for creating a better socio-economic life in harmony with nature.
